If a maximum receive unit (MRU) size is specified, use it for RX buffers allocation instead of the MTU.
Signed-off-by: Loic Poulain <loic.poul...@linaro.org> --- drivers/net/mhi/mhi.h | 1 + drivers/net/mhi/net.c | 4 +++- 2 files changed, 4 insertions(+), 1 deletion(-) diff --git a/drivers/net/mhi/mhi.h b/drivers/net/mhi/mhi.h index 12e7407..1d0c499 100644 --- a/drivers/net/mhi/mhi.h +++ b/drivers/net/mhi/mhi.h @@ -29,6 +29,7 @@ struct mhi_net_dev { struct mhi_net_stats stats; u32 rx_queue_sz; int msg_enable; + unsigned int mru; }; struct mhi_net_proto { diff --git a/drivers/net/mhi/net.c b/drivers/net/mhi/net.c index b1769fb..4bef7fe 100644 --- a/drivers/net/mhi/net.c +++ b/drivers/net/mhi/net.c @@ -270,10 +270,12 @@ static void mhi_net_rx_refill_work(struct work_struct *work) rx_refill.work); struct net_device *ndev = mhi_netdev->ndev; struct mhi_device *mdev = mhi_netdev->mdev; - int size = READ_ONCE(ndev->mtu); struct sk_buff *skb; + unsigned int size; int err; + size = mhi_netdev->mru ? mhi_netdev->mru : READ_ONCE(ndev->mtu); + while (!mhi_queue_is_full(mdev, DMA_FROM_DEVICE)) { skb = netdev_alloc_skb(ndev, size); if (unlikely(!skb)) -- 2.7.4
